The Full Checklist
SEO Essentials to Cover
Metadata & Basics
- ✅ Unique page title (under 60 characters)
- ✅ Meta description written for clicks
- ✅ Canonical tag present and accurate
Headers & Structure
- ✅ Only one H1 per page
- ✅ Headers (H2–H4) follow visual hierarchy
- ✅ Keywords appear in at least one H2
Keyword Optimization
- ✅ Primary keyword used in first 100 words
- ✅ Secondary keywords placed naturally (no stuffing)
- ✅ Synonyms used throughout content
Media & Accessibility
- ✅ All images have descriptive alt text
- ✅ File names include keywords
- ✅ Image size optimized for speed
Links & Engagement
- ✅ 2–3 internal links to related content
- ✅ At least 1 outbound authoritative link
- ✅ Anchor text is descriptive and natural
Technical On-Page
- ✅ URL is short, clean, and keyword-rich
- ✅ Page is mobile-friendly and passes Core Web Vitals
- ✅ Structured data markup added if relevant
